Software engineering teams often wake up to the harsh reality that a pristine green dashboard in the staging environment offers zero protection against a catastrophic failure in the live production cloud. This disconnect represents a fundamental shift in the digital landscape where the “it worked in staging” excuse has become a relic of a simpler era. Despite a suite of passing functional tests, cloud-native applications frequently crumble under the weight of real-world traffic, revealing hidden performance regressions and security drifts that standard checks fail to capture. The critical disconnect lies in the binary nature of traditional testing; when a system is distributed across dozens of microservices, a simple “pass” or “fail” is no longer enough information to maintain reliability.
A growing number of organizations now realize that the silent killers of system stability are not the obvious bugs but the complex, emergent behaviors that occur only at scale. These hidden issues include database connection pool exhaustion or subtle latency spikes that ripple through a service mesh. Maintaining a competitive edge requires more than just code correctness; it necessitates deep contextual awareness. When every micro-interaction can impact the user experience, the lack of granularity in traditional testing frameworks becomes a liability, pushing teams toward a more data-centric approach to quality assurance.
The High Cost of Green Lights and Production Crashes
The reliance on isolated test environments often creates a false sense of security that evaporates the moment code hits a distributed production cluster. Traditional continuous integration pipelines are designed to validate logic, yet they frequently miss the environmental nuances that trigger outages, such as misconfigured auto-scaling groups or secret rotation errors. These failures are not merely technical inconveniences; they translate into significant financial losses and eroded customer trust. For companies operating at high velocity, a single undetected performance regression can degrade global response times, leading to a measurable drop in user retention and revenue.
Furthermore, the lack of visibility into the internal state of an application during testing means that developers are often troubleshooting in the dark when a failure occurs. Without telemetry, a failed test case provides a symptom but no path to the root cause, leading to long hours of log combing and manual reproduction attempts. The industry has reached a tipping point where the volume of data produced by modern systems makes manual debugging unsustainable. As a result, the focus is shifting away from simple verification and toward a model of continuous validation that treats every test run as a source of rich, actionable data.
Why Traditional Testing Fails the Cloud-Native Stress Test
As organizations migrate to serverless architectures and multi-cloud environments, the complexity of inter-service dependencies has outpaced the capabilities of standard quality gates. Traditional testing treats the application as a black box, focusing on outputs rather than the internal state, which leaves teams vulnerable to ephemeral errors and latency spikes. Because cloud-native systems are dynamic and inherently unpredictable, static test scripts cannot account for the myriad of ways a network partition or a cold start might disrupt a transaction. This gap between the test script and the production reality is where most modern outages are born.
Recent research into high-performing engineering cultures highlights a growing trend: mature teams are shifting their perspective to view testing as an observability problem. By integrating telemetry into the testing lifecycle, these teams have achieved three times faster recovery rates and slashed production incidents by 50 percent. This data proves that context is just as vital as code correctness. Instead of asking if a feature works, engineers are now asking how the feature behaves under varying load conditions and how it interacts with the broader ecosystem of shared services. This shift allows for the detection of “gray failures” that do not immediately crash the system but slowly degrade its health.
From Binary Gates to Rich Telemetry Signals
Modern continuous testing has evolved into a sophisticated data-gathering operation where every test execution emits OpenTelemetry spans to create a unified dataset. This transformation is anchored by four pillars: functional API traces that map serverless cold starts, integration maps that visualize multi-cloud latency, performance profiles that identify auto-scaling thresholds, and security telemetry that tracks attack surface evolution. The integration of these signals ensures that a deployment is not just functionally sound but also operationally resilient.
Instead of isolated failures, teams now see correlated events—such as a failed integration test being linked directly to a database connection pool exhaustion across fifteen different microservices. This level of insight transforms the testing process from a hurdle into a diagnostic engine. For instance, when a performance test fails, the associated trace might reveal that a specific third-party API call has doubled in latency, allowing the team to address the dependency before it impacts live users. Moreover, by using these telemetry signals to inform automated decision-making, organizations can implement self-healing pipelines that adjust resources or block deployments based on real-time performance data rather than arbitrary thresholds.
Quantifying the Impact of Observability-Driven Quality
Expert analysis of modern DevSecOps workflows reveals that treating security as an observability signal can reduce vulnerability backlogs by as much as 65 percent. By layering Runtime Application Self-Protection signals with automated scanning, teams gain the ability to visualize entire attack paths. This might involve identifying a vulnerable library and tracing its potential lateral movement through the network in real time. This proactive stance on security shifts the burden away from reactive patching and toward a model where the system’s own telemetry identifies and mitigates risks as they emerge during the testing phase.
Furthermore, the use of synthetic testing at cloud scale—running browser-based journeys across global regions every 60 seconds—allows site reliability engineers to catch regressions before they impact the end-user experience. These data-driven insights move the needle from reactive firefighting to proactive system hardening, backed by real-world performance metrics rather than theoretical benchmarks. When synthetic tests are integrated with observability platforms, a failure in a specific region can automatically trigger a chaos engineering experiment to test the failover capabilities of the architecture. This continuous loop of testing, observing, and hardening creates a robust environment capable of withstanding the volatility of the cloud.
A Strategic Roadmap for Implementation and Scaling
Transitioning to an observability-driven testing model requires a phased approach that starts with instrumenting critical paths, such as login and checkout flows, with OpenTelemetry. The first phase focuses on establishing a foundation through test observability dashboards and canary analysis. This allows teams to visualize the baseline behavior of their most important transactions. Once the foundation is set, teams should scale by incorporating global synthetic monitoring and machine-learning-powered test classification to separate “flaky” tests from genuine architectural breaks. This filtering is essential for maintaining developer productivity and preventing alert fatigue. The final stage involves reaching autonomous operations, where site reliability agents leverage historical patterns and load signals to predict failures and auto-remediate issues. To measure success, organizations must define Service Level Objectives specifically for their testing pipelines, ensuring that the speed of delivery never compromises the stability of the production environment. These objectives should include metrics like the time to detect a regression and the accuracy of automated rollbacks. By treating the testing pipeline itself as a production service, engineering leaders ensured that their quality processes were as resilient and observable as the applications they were designed to protect. The move toward this model proved that when testing and observability converged, the resulting insights provided a clear path toward sustainable, high-velocity software delivery. Professionals found that the most effective strategy involved starting small by instrumenting a single critical path, which eventually led to a comprehensive source of truth that accelerated debugging by four times. This evolution shifted the focus from merely checking boxes to understanding the intricate heartbeat of the entire cloud ecosystem.
